02 Purpose and work
What the charity exists to do
CCT’s founding documents list five purposes which must be exercised following the principles of sustainable development as follows: Managing community land for the benefit of the community Improving recreational facilities and activities Advancing community development Advancing community education about its environment, culture, heritage and history Enhancing environmental protection

Constitutional objectives
The Company has been formed to benefit the community of Culbokie as defined by the postcode units IV7 8GW, IV7 8GX, IV7 8GY, IV7 8GZ, IV7 8HU, IV7 8JB, IV7 8JD, IV7 8JF, IV7 8JH, IV7 8JJ, IV7 8Jl, IV7 8JN, IV7 8JP, IV7 8JQ, IV7 8JR, IV7 8JS, IV7 8JW, IV7 8JX, IV7 8JY, IV7 8JZ, IV7 8LA, IV7 8lB, IV7 8lF, IV7 8lS, IV7 8NA, IV7 8NB, IV7 8ND, IV7 8NE, IV7 8NF ('the Community'), with the Purposes listed in the sub-clauses hereto ('the Purposes'), to be exercised following the principles of sustainable development (where sustainable development means development which meets the needs of the present without compromising the ability of future generations to meet their own needs), namely: 4.1 To manage community land and associated assets for the benefit of the Community and the public in general. 4.2 To provide, or assist in providing, recreational facilities, and/or organising recreational activities, which will be available to members of the Community and public at large with the object of improving the conditions of life of the Community. 4.3 To advance community development, including urban or rural regeneration within the Community. 4.4 To advance the education of the Community about its environment, culture, heritage and/or history. 4.5 To advance environmental protection or improvement including preservation, sustainable development and conservation of the natural environment, the maintenance, improvement or provision of environmental amenities for the Community and/or the preservation of buildings or sites of architectural, historic or other importance to the Community.
